 Family Medical Leave Act Minimize

Under the Family Medical Leave Act, eligible employees may be granted up to a total of 12 weeks of unpaid leave during any 12 month period for one or more of the following reasons:

  • For the birth and care of the newborn child of the employee

  • For placement with the employee of a son or daughter for adoption or foster care

  • To care for an immediate family member (spouse, child, or parent) with a serious health condition

  • To take medical leave when the employee is unable to work because of a serious health condition
